Our versatile Pasquino scarf. One side features a refined herringbone pattern, while the other boasts a classic paisley design, giving you two sophisticated looks in one scarf.

As a teenager in Rome, my friends and I sometimes visited the Pasquino cinema in Trastevere, a neighborhood rich in history. The name Pasquino traces back to Rome's first "talking statue,” This ancient statue, dating back to the 3rd century BC, became a voice for the people, with anonymous satirical messages attached to its base. Even today, Romans use Pasquino to share their witty takes on politics and life.

Wearing the Pasquino Silk Scarf, you carry a piece of this spirited tradition with you, blending timeless elegance with a touch of Roman heritage.

Details

  • Sized for a perfect drape: Approx: 8.5” x 70” (22cm x 180cm). This allows for an elegant look that sets you apart. Most men's scarves of this type are available in a 60"-63" (152cm-160cm) length which is simply too short for most men for adequate coverage and drape.

  • Double-sided: This means that silk is on both sides, so no matter how you wear it, it looks great.

  • Hand-fringed hem: The short ends are left open with an eyelash hem. This keeps the scarf from curling and looks fabulous, too!

  • 100% silk twill: A soft, silky fabric traditionally used in men's tailoring for its look and drape. Characterized by a diagonal weave which makes it very durable.

  • Limited edition: We make these in small quantities, so you know your scarf is truly one-of-a-kind.

  • Pure luxury, naturally dyed: We use non-toxic vegetable dyes that preserve the silk's softness, free from harmful chemicals that can irritate your skin (and is better for the planet!)

  • Affordable luxury: We bring these directly from the people who make them to you. There are no massive markups and middlemen, which keeps our prices remarkably reasonable.

  • 100% Handmade in Italy: Printed, cut and sewn along the shores of Lake Como.

Works well. You need to drill a 3/8” hole
Appears to be well made, alignment bar slides in nicely. As stated, you need to drill a hole in the bar for the gimble bearing driver, the directions are not clear, what I did was before I take out the old gimble bearing, put an O ring on the bar close to the last step on the bar, slide the bar all the way in, then carefully slide the bar out, this marks the distance from the back of the gimble bearing to where the shaft on the outdrive bottoms out, move the O ring a 1/4” towards the stepped part of the alignment tool (this is so you won’t bottom out the alignment tool when driving the gimble bearing in) then slide the driver puck up to the O ring and use a 3/8” diameter transfer punch through the side hole in the puck to mark the bar. You need to drill a 3/8” diameter hole in the alignment bar, two V blocks, some clamps, and a drill press will make drilling much easier, after the bar is securely mounted and centered in the drill press, use a center drill, then 1/4” drill first, using plenty of oil, drill all the way through, then use the 3/8” drill, deburr both sides and you should be good to go. People complain that it doesn’t come pre-drilled, the reason is that not all out drives are the same so you have to fit it to the outdrive that you have. Fortunately, I have a machine shop at my house and have a jig setup with various drill bushings, but the method I described above should work for you. Just make sure you’re perfectly centered and secure before you start drilling.
